The Davenport City Council held a meeting on August 12, 2026, focusing primarily on fiscal responsibility and budgetary concerns in light of new property tax legislation expected to impact the city's 2028 fiscal year budget. A key motion was discussed and ultimately approved to reaffirm the council's commitment to fiscal discipline, including a directive to staff to prioritize existing council policies and operate within the adopted budget. The motion also included a hiring freeze on new full-time positions not previously authorized in the 2027 budget until the fiscal impact of the new tax laws is fully understood. Council members debated the motion's language and process, with some advocating for postponement to allow for more information and public input, while others supported immediate adoption to signal fiscal prudence. Additionally, public comments proposed integrating AI technology into city services to improve communication and efficiency, and discussed community involvement in renovating a local concession stand. The meeting also addressed procedural rules regarding agenda item additions and suspensions of rules, highlighting a need for clearer guidelines moving forward.
